Fig. 2. Rfx6 LOF leads to decreased expression of foregut and pancreas markers early in pancreas development. (A) Western blot with anti-flag antibody of in vitro TnT assay of translation. This demonstrates that MO1 prevents translation of rfx6 mRNA, while the mis-match morpholino (MM) does not. Rfx6 mRNA, flag-tagged rfx6 mRNA plasmid; MM, mis-match morpholino. (B) Diagramatic representation of RT-PCR test of MO2 efficiency. (C) RT-PCR performed on wild-type (WT) and MO2-injected tadpoles. WT mRNA is processed leaving the reverse primer unable to bind resulting in no amplification in the Rfx6 panel. MO2 blocks mRNA processing at the intron 2 donor site (5' end of the intron) as demonstrated by the presence of PCR product in MO2 lane. Ef1α is a housekeeping gene used as a loading control. (D, E) Hnf6 expression is reduced in the morphant foregut endoderm at NF25 (24/28 reduced). (F, G) FoxA2 expression is reduced in the morphant foregut endoderm at NF25 (17/28). (H, I) Hnf6 expression is reduced in the morphant foregut at NF35 (10/13 reduced). (J, K) Pdx1 expression is reduced in the morphant (17/19 reduced). (L, M) Ptf1a expression is reduced in both the dorsal (arrow) and ventral (arrowhead) pancreatic buds of the morphant (n = 18). (N, O) Early insulin expression in the dorsal pancreatic bud (arrow) is lost in morphant tissue (56/62 reduced). Control tadpoles were injected with 25 ng mis-match morpholino. |

Fig. 3. Rfx6 is required for pancreas differentiation. Whole mount in situ hybridizations of NF42 whole guts from morphant (MO1) and mis-match (control) tadpoles. (A–D) Expression of pancreatic transcription factors pdx1 (n = 18) and ptf1a (n = 18) is almost completely abolished in morphant tissue. (E, F) Expression of acinar marker elastase is reduced (n = 16). (G, H) Schematic illustrating organs in the whole gut. Pink, liver; red, gall bladder; blue, pancreas; yellow, stomach, duodenum and intestine. (I, J) β cell marker insulin is reduced (72/75 reduced). (K–N) Glucagon and somatostatin, both markers of endocrine cells in the pancreas and stomach are reduced (glucagon n = 18, somatostatin 15/16 reduced). (O, P) NeuroD, developmental endocrine cell marker, is reduced (n = 17). |
